Key Insights

The neurostimulation devices market, valued at $8.21 billion in 2025, is projected to experience robust growth, driven by a compound annual growth rate (CAGR) of 12.50% from 2025 to 2033. This expansion is fueled by several key factors. The rising prevalence of neurological disorders like Parkinson's disease, epilepsy, and chronic pain is significantly increasing the demand for effective treatment options. Neurostimulation offers a minimally invasive and targeted approach compared to traditional therapies, contributing to its market appeal. Technological advancements leading to smaller, more sophisticated devices with improved efficacy and longer battery life are also driving adoption. Furthermore, the growing awareness among patients and healthcare professionals regarding the benefits of neurostimulation, coupled with supportive regulatory environments in key markets, is further accelerating market growth. The market is segmented by device type (implantable and external), application (Parkinson's disease, epilepsy, depression, dystonia, pain management, and others), and end-users (clinics, hospitals, and rehabilitation centers). Implantable devices currently dominate the market share, but external devices are showing promising growth due to their ease of use and reduced invasiveness. North America holds a significant market share currently, followed by Europe and Asia Pacific, with emerging markets in the Asia Pacific region anticipated to show strong growth in the forecast period due to increasing healthcare infrastructure and rising disposable incomes.

The competitive landscape is characterized by a mix of established players like Medtronic and Boston Scientific, alongside emerging companies focused on innovation. Strategic partnerships, acquisitions, and the development of novel neurostimulation technologies are shaping the market dynamics. While challenges remain, such as high costs associated with devices and procedures, and potential side effects, the overall market outlook for neurostimulation devices is positive, driven by technological advancements, a growing elderly population requiring treatment for age-related neurological disorders, and the potential for expansion into new applications and therapeutic areas. The market is expected to surpass $30 billion by 2033, reflecting the significant unmet needs and continued growth potential of this sector.

Key Developments in Neurostimulation Devices Industry Industry

  • May 2023: Abbott received FDA approval for its spinal cord stimulation (SCS) systems for treating non-surgical chronic back pain, expanding its market reach significantly.
  • January 2023: Axonics, Inc. received FDA approval for its fourth-generation rechargeable sacral neuromodulation system, enhancing market competition and offering patients an improved technology.

8. Can you provide examples of recent developments in the market?

May 2023: Abbott received FDA approval for its spinal cord stimulation (SCS) systems for treating chronic back pain in people who have not had or are not eligible to receive back surgery, known as non-surgical back pain. This new indication applies to all Abbott's SCS products in the United States, including the Eterna SCS platform and the Proclaim SCS family.
